​In furtherance of the fight against transnational organised crime, operatives of the Nigeria Police Force attached to the National Central Bureau (NCB-INTERPOL), Lagos Annex, have successfully rescued two foreign nationals lured to Nigeria and held captive by a human trafficking syndicate.

​Force Public Relations Officer, CSP Aniete Iniedu, made this known on Saturday, saying, “The successful operation followed actionable intelligence received from INTERPOL-NCB, Bogotá, on August 26, 2026, regarding two female citizens of Colombia, identified as Maria Camila Rodas Ortiz and Yuliet Fernanda Rios Mesa.

“The victims were fraudulently lured to Nigeria, held against their will, and had their travel documents confiscated by certain Chinese nationals who are currently at large.
